Synopsis
In the vibrant and whimsical world of 2014's The Lego Movie, viewers are introduced to Emmet, an utterly average Lego mini-figure who leads a mundane life in the bustling city of Bricksburg. Little does he know that his life is about to take a thrilling turn. Mistakenly identified as the prophesied MasterBuilder, Emmet is thrust into an epic adventure alongside a diverse cast of characters, including the fearless Wyldstyle and the enigmatic Vitruvius. Their mission? To thwart the malevolent plans of Lord Business, a tyrant intent on using a powerful weapon to impose his rigid order upon the Lego universe.
